The Old Harbour ( Aquarium and Cotton Warehouse / Cotone Congressi area ) |
|
The Old Harbour is only 450 metres from the Hotel. It is an area within what was called the old harbour, that is the area where they used to load and unload goods going to and coming from countries overseas.  This area was turned into a tourist area for the 1992 games in honour of Christopher Columbus and several new attractions were set up: the Aquarium, the Bigo (sightseeing elevator), the De Amicis Library, the Biospèhere, the Cotone Congressi of Genoa, the Galata Museum of the sea, the children’s fun fair, the old Galleon Neptune, the Luzzati Museum, the Antarctica National Museum, the ice skating ring and the Marina Molo or tourist port, |

THE HISTORICAL CENTRE |
|
The Balbi Hotel is the ideal choice for all those who wish to visit the historical centre of Genoa and to discover all its 17th century palaces. The Hotel is only a few minutes’ walk from Garibaldi street, that has been declared UNESCO World Heritage because of its Strada Nuova Museums: Palazzo Rosso, Palazzo Bianco, Tursi. Nearby you can visit the splendid Palazzo Ducale (Ducal palace), De Ferrari square, and the Carlo Felice Opera House . A short walk will take you also to St.Lawrence street and its Cathedral and to the two areas in the historical centre called Piazza delle erbe and Canpo Pisano, that are famous for their typical coffee bars and night life. |
